Historical Background

Rose as a color name predates its association with the flower—the Old English word referenced a range of warm pinkish-red hues. During the Renaissance, rose madder pigment (from the madder plant root) was a staple of portrait painters, prized for realistic skin tones. In Victorian flower language, different rose colors carried coded messages: pink for admiration, red for love, white for purity.

HEX Web
#E08BAB

Hexadecimal is the web’s universal color notation — two digits each for red, green and blue. Drop it straight into HTML, CSS or any design tool.

RGB Screen
rgb(224, 139, 171)

RGB is the additive Red-Green-Blue model every screen uses to emit light. The default choice for websites, apps and on-screen UI.

HSL Web
hsl(337, 58%, 71%)

HSL breaks a color into Hue, Saturation and Lightness — the most intuitive way to lighten, darken or mute a color in CSS.

HSV HSB Design
hsv(337, 38%, 88%)

HSV (also called HSB) maps Hue, Saturation and Value/Brightness. It is the model behind the color pickers in Photoshop, Figma and most design apps.

HWB CSS 4
hwb(337 55% 12%)

HWB blends a pure hue with Whiteness and Blackness — a painter-friendly model added in CSS Color 4 for quick tints and shades.

CMYK Print
cmyk(0%, 38%, 24%, 12%)

CMYK is the subtractive Cyan-Magenta-Yellow-Black ink model. Use these values when preparing artwork for a printer or commercial press.

OKLCH Modern
oklch(73.38% 0.110 356.04)

OKLCH is a modern, perceptually-uniform space (Lightness, Chroma, Hue). It powers smooth gradients and accessible palettes in today’s CSS.

OKLab Modern
oklab(73.38% 0.110 -0.008)

OKLab is the Cartesian form of OKLCH — ideal for blending and interpolating colors without the muddy midpoints older spaces produce.

CIELAB L*a*b* Perceptual
L: 67.47, a: 36.53, b: -3.08

CIELAB is a device-independent, perceptually-uniform space. It is the standard for measuring color difference (ΔE) and matching across devices.

LCH Perceptual
L: 67.47, C: 36.65, H: 355.18

LCH is CIELAB in cylindrical form — Lightness, Chroma and Hue — letting you adjust vividness and hue while staying perceptually even.

XYZ CIE Science
X: 47.32, Y: 37.25, Z: 43.22

CIE XYZ is the 1931 master space that underpins every other model here — the scientific bridge used to convert between color systems.

Decimal int Code
14715819

The 24-bit integer value of the color — handy for databases, APIs, game engines and low-level graphics code.

Good to know

Frequently Asked Questions about #E08BAB

#E08BAB is a warm color from the Rose family. Its closest matched name is “Pomelo Red”, matched perceptually with the CIEDE2000 color-difference formula. In RGB it is rgb(224, 139, 171); in HSL, hsl(337, 58%, 71%).
In RGB, #E08BAB is rgb(224, 139, 171); in HSL it is hsl(337, 58%, 71%); and in CMYK — the model used for print — it is cmyk(0%, 38%, 24%, 12%).
#E08BAB has a contrast ratio of 8.45:1 against black and 2.49:1 against white. For readability, black body text meets the WCAG AA threshold of 4.5:1 on it, while white does not.
